  1. Dictionary
    minute
    /ˈmɪnɪt/

    noun

    • 1. a period of time equal to sixty seconds or a sixtieth of an hour: "we waited for twenty minutes"
    • 2. a sixtieth of a degree of angular measurement (symbol: ʹ): "Delta Lyrae is a double star with a separation of over 10 minutes of arc"
